This Creamy Mushroom Chicken is the perfect one-pan meal for busy nights. Juicy chicken breasts are cooked to golden perfection, then simmered in a rich, creamy mushroom sauce with garlic and herbs. It’s easy to make, requires minimal cleanup, and offers a comforting blend of flavors that the whole family will love.
Ingredients
-
4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
-
2 tbsp olive oil, 3 garlic cloves (minced)
-
2 cups sliced mushrooms (button or cremini)
-
¾ cup heavy cream, ½ cup chicken broth
-
Salt, pepper, and fresh thyme for garnish
Directions
-
Sear the Chicken: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Season chicken breasts with salt and pepper, and cook for 5-6 minutes per side until golden brown. Set aside.
-
Cook the Mushrooms: In the same pan, sauté mushrooms with garlic until they release moisture and become golden.
-
Make the Sauce: Add chicken broth and heavy cream to the pan, scraping up any browned bits. Let the sauce simmer for 3-4 minutes.
-
Combine: Return the chicken to the pan, spoon the sauce over it, and simmer for another 5 minutes until the chicken is cooked through.
-
Serve: Garnish with fresh thyme and serve hot with rice or mashed potatoes.
